HRTL-One DVR Quick Start Guide
Step 1: Unpack everything
Your HRTL-One comes with the following items:
One single channel HRTL-One Digital Video Recorder
One hard drive cartridge (hard drive not included) and a
key for the cartridge (located inside drive carrier)
One power converter and power cord
One rack mounting kit
HRTL-One Digital Video Recorder User Guide
External I/O connector
80 GB Hard Drive (included with HRTL-One-80 DVR,
not included with HRTL-One DVR)

Step 3: Install hard drive
5. Ensure hard drive is configured as Master. Refer to the
documentation that came with the hard drive for the
jumper settings.
6. Insert cables on hard drive.

7. Secure the hard drive into the hard drive cartridge using
the four #6-32 screws supplied.

9. Turn the key lock to the A position before
powering on. This will ensure that the hard drive
A
functions normally.
B
A = ON (Locked, hard drive cannot be removed)
B = OFF (Unlocked, hard drive can be removed)
